Elizabeth Fry is the woman famous for prison reform who is featured on the back of a 5 pound note. Born in 1780, Fry was a prominent English Quaker who dedicated her life to improving the conditions of prisons and advocating for the rights of inmates. Her work in prison reform led to significant changes in the way prisoners were treated and helped to bring about a more humane approach to incarceration.

Elizabeth Fry's efforts in prison reform were groundbreaking at the time and have had a lasting impact on the criminal justice system. She believed in the power of education and rehabilitation, rather than punishment, as a means of reforming prisoners. Fry also worked to improve the living conditions of inmates, providing them with better food, clothing, and access to education and religious services.

Today, Elizabeth Fry is remembered as a pioneer in the field of prison reform and her legacy continues to inspire others to work towards creating a more just and compassionate criminal justice system. Her image on the back of the 5 pound note serves as a reminder of her important contributions to society.
